A Fresh Twist on a Classic Court GameThe steady click-clack of a shuttlecock hitting a racket string is a familiar soundtrack in public parks. On most weekends, badminton is a casual pastime played between picnics and afternoon strolls. However, a growing trend is transforming this relaxed backyard sport into an endurance spectacle: the themed badminton marathon. By merging the physical challenge of a long-duration tournament with the creative energy of a costume party, local communities are breathing vibrant new life into the local park ecosystem.Unlike standard tournaments that focus strictly on elimination brackets and rigid ranking systems, a badminton marathon prioritizes stamina, community engagement, and visual flair. Players sign up for multi-hour stretches, keeping the courts active from dawn until dusk. The introduction of specific themes—ranging from retro eighties athletic wear to futuristic neon glow-in-the-dark gear—elevates the event from a simple athletic gathering into an immersive neighborhood festival that draws crowds of curious spectators.

Transforming the Grass into a Grand StageExecuting a successful marathon requires converting standard park lawns into functional, high-visibility arenas. Organizers erect multiple portable nets, marking boundaries with bright, eco-friendly chalk that keeps the grass unharmed. Banners reflecting the chosen theme flutter in the breeze, while a central registration table serves as the logistical heartbeat of the event, tracking player rotations and cumulative match scores over the course of the day.The visual impact of the theme modifies the entire atmosphere of the park. When a tournament adopts a vintage Wimbledon theme, the courts fill with players sporting classic wooden rackets, pleated white skirts, and traditional terrycloth headbands. Conversely, a tropical luau theme brings a wave of Hawaiian shirts, grass skirts, and floral leis that flutter mid-air during a dramatic smash. This aesthetic commitment turns every rally into a performance, forcing players to balance athletic agility with the comedic restrictions of their elaborate outfits.

The Endurance Challenge and Player DynamicsBeneath the humorous costumes and festive music lies a genuine test of physical endurance. Badminton is an incredibly fast-paced sport, demanding rapid lateral movements, explosive jumps, and constant mental alertness. Extending this intensity over a marathon format requires strategic pacing and robust team cooperation. Most marathons utilize a tag-team or rotating doubles format, ensuring that the courts remain occupied while giving individual players time to rest and hydrate.As the hours tick away, the nature of the matches begins to shift. The initial burst of competitive adrenaline matures into a shared battle against fatigue. Players who started the morning as rivals find themselves cheering for one another by mid-afternoon, united by the collective goal of keeping the shuttlecock airborne for a record-breaking number of hours. The park benches turn into supportive dugout spaces where participants share energy bars, stretch tight calves, and laugh over the absurdity of diving for a drop shot while dressed as a giant inflatable dinosaur.

Fostering Community Spirit in Public SpacesThe true triumph of a themed badminton marathon is its unique ability to unite diverse groups of people within a shared public space. Regular park visitors, dog walkers, and families out for a stroll are naturally drawn to the spectacle of color and sound. The casual nature of the event breaks down the social barriers that often isolate urban residents, encouraging spontaneous interactions and making the park feel like a cohesive neighborhood backyard.To maximize this community impact, organizers frequently pair the athletic marathon with charitable initiatives or local business partnerships. Spectators can pledge donations for every hour the courts remain active, or purchase raffle tickets from local vendors stationed near the boundary lines. Food trucks and acoustic musicians often set up along the perimeter, turning the sporting event into a broader celebration of local culture, health, and mutual support.
